Anna Moreno

1984, lives and works at The Hague, Netherlands

Anna Moreno is a visual artist and researcher living between Barcelona and The Hague. Her practice explores the unfinished nature of historical and speculative events through installations, films, and performative encounters that weave together utopian architecture and fictional narratives.

She has held solo exhibitions such as Bash Na Bash at HAUS – Space for Contemporary Practices (Barcelona, 2025), and Costa Paraíso at House of Chappaz (Barcelona) and Joey Ramone Gallery (Rotterdam, 2023). Her work has also been featured in group shows such as In Focus at the TEA Biennial (Tenerife, 2024), Beehave at Fundació Joan Miró (Barcelona), and in screenings at Arquiteturas Film Festival (Porto, 2025) and Cineteca Matadero (Madrid, 2024).

She was a resident at the Jan Van Eyck Academie (Maastricht, 2019–2020) and is currently developing Oceanographies, a film trilogy supported by TBA21 that connects the ports of Rotterdam, Venice, and Barcelona. In 2026, she will present new solo exhibitions in Barcelona and Nancy, France.
